Why does my 13 amp plug keep burning out?

Electrical sockets and plugs are essential components of our everyday lives. Most of us rely heavily on them to power our appliances and electronic devices. However, you may have encountered a frustrating situation where your 13 amp plug keeps burning out. In this article, we will explore the possible reasons behind this issue and provide some solutions.

Inadequate Wiring or Overloading

One possible reason why your 13 amp plug keeps burning out is inadequate wiring or overloading. If the wiring in your house is old or faulty, it can lead to excessive heat buildup in the plug, causing it to burn out. Another common cause is overloading the electrical circuit by connecting too many high-wattage appliances to a single plug.

To address this issue, it is crucial to ensure that your house's electrical system is up to code. Consider hiring a professional electrician to inspect and upgrade the wiring if needed. Additionally, distribute the load evenly across different plugs and circuits to prevent overloading, especially when using power-hungry devices.

Faulty Plug or Socket

A faulty plug or socket can also be a culprit behind repeated burnouts. When plugs and sockets become worn out or damaged, they can result in poor electrical connections, loose connections, or even short circuits. This can generate excessive heat and ultimately cause the plug to burn out.

If you notice any visible signs of damage, such as burnt marks or loose-fitting plugs, replace them immediately. Consider investing in high-quality plugs and sockets that meet safety standards to minimize the risk of burnouts.

Poor Maintenance and Misuse

Insufficient maintenance and misuse of plugs can accelerate their wear and tear, leading to burnouts. For example, pulling the plug out by yanking the cord instead of gripping the plug itself can damage the internal wiring, causing a poor connection and overheating.

To avoid this, make sure to handle plugs with care and pull them out firmly but gently by gripping the plug-head. Regularly inspect the cords for any fraying or damage and replace them if necessary. Additionally, keep plugs and sockets clean and free from dust or debris that could interfere with their proper functioning.

In conclusion, several factors can contribute to your 13 amp plug burning out. Inadequate wiring, overloading, faulty plugs or sockets, poor maintenance, and misuse are all potential causes. By addressing these issues and following proper electrical safety practices, you can prevent burnouts and ensure the longevity of your plugs and sockets.
